Q: How are corrections applied to the Lumipoints ledger?
A: Append-only. Corrections are compensating entries, never edits. Each entry is signed by the ledger service key held in Vantor's internal vault. Reconciliation runs nightly; discrepancies page the on-call. Auditors get read-only snapshots. If the signing key must be rotated out-of-band, the recovery workflow requires the ledger passphrase, which is:

vault phrase of bagaf-kajeg = jorath-feniel-briir-siliel-ralix

### Step 4: Configure the resizer CLI

The `pixtrim` batch resizer runs as a cron-driven job on the media hosts. Copy `pixtrim.env.example` to `/etc/pixtrim/pixtrim.env` and set `PIXTRIM_CONCURRENCY=8` and `PIXTRIM_OUTPUT_BUCKET=media-resized`. If the queue backs up past 10k items, page the media team rather than raising concurrency. The CLI authenticates to the asset store with a token; it reads this from the same env file at startup. Add the token assignment as the next line in the file.

sealed setting: RELAY_SECRET5=82864

**Q: How do staff enter through the shuttle-bus gate at the Dunmore Park campus?**

The shuttle-bus gate on the east perimeter opens automatically for inbound shuttles between 06:30 and 19:00. Staff arriving on foot via this gate must use the pedestrian side door, not the vehicle barrier. Reception should remind visitors that this entrance is for badge holders only; guests must be escorted. The side door requires the current gate code, which is listed below for reception reference.

turnstile pass: bdg-JBCWS-7